Enicar Ocean Pearl Alarm Unpolished
The Enicar Ocean Pearl Alarm is a very rare watch that most people have never heard of. When you ask knowledgeable vintage watch enthusiasts to cite the manufacturers that made Alarm Dive watches - they will immediately say “The Jaeger-LeCoultre Deep Sea Alarm”, “The Polaris of course!”, or begin screaming “Vulcain Cricket Nautical, Vulcain Cricket Nautical, Vulcain Cricket Nautical!” 😱 (Yes, these conversations do occur). However, there is also an Enicar dive alarm watch - also with an EPSA case! These watches are incredibly cool, and compact dive models. It features the A. Schilds calibre. The case measures 35mm in diameter by 44mm in length. The case is unpolished. The bracelet is a later unsigned model that looks very nice on the watch. It features an Explorer dial layout and rotating bezel.
